Unionville has gone 8-0 against Oxford recently and they'll look to pad the win column further on Monday. The Unionville Longhorns will welcome the Oxford Hornets at 5:00 p.m. Unionville will be looking to keep their 15-game home win streak dating back to last season alive.
Last Tuesday, Unionville earned a 3-1 victory over Downingtown West.
The final score came out to 25-21, 25-18, 22-25, 25-19.
Aliz Uejima was nothing short of spectacular: she had 19 digs and three aces. That high mark didn't come from nowhere: she now had 11 or more in the last three games she's played dating back to last season.
Unionville was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 12 aces. That's the most aces they've posted in their last five matches.
Meanwhile, Oxford was able to grind out a solid win over Octorara Area on Saturday, taking the game 3-1.
Oxford had a slow start but a hot finish: after dropping the first set, they turned around to win the next three. The match finished with set scores of 19-25, 25-18, 25-19, 25-17.
Grace Lair had an outrageously good game as she had 12 digs and five aces. The dominant performance gave her a new career-high in aces.
Unionville is on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six games, which lines up perfectly with their 7-1-1 record this season. As for Oxford, their victory bumped their record up to 7-4-2.
